Output 8520400c5bb31631ed4a72e2b3954cc29b40d29ed4a43f02f126eda6c3051ff5:0

value
19494139
script pubkey
OP_0 OP_PUSHBYTES_20 5f77fbb6db2f2833a5a4ac974e6a3d711ab17fdf
address
bc1qtamlhdkm9u5r8fdy4jt5u63awydtzl7lc50uxp
transaction
8520400c5bb31631ed4a72e2b3954cc29b40d29ed4a43f02f126eda6c3051ff5
spent
true